I'd maybe add some more detail to the wall, but I can understand that you've grown tired of working on it. :P The smudgie sigs aren't a bad start, but you need to clean them up a bit. Try to make the smudging look less 'transparent' too. If you're using Gimp, try these setting (they're Soa's, not mine): Hard round brush 19 px, spacing 1, rate 90, no jitter, opacity 100 (I think).
